
The Policy Coordinator role at CAIR San Francisco Bay Area focuses on advocating for inclusive policies impacting Muslims and the broader public. The position involves building relationships with elected officials, conducting legislative research, and drafting policy briefs to advance civil rights and anti-racist initiatives. Key duties include collaborating with community teams to gather data on Islamophobia, co-leading election engagement efforts, and mobilizing stakeholders around priority issues. The role offers a hybrid work arrangement with a minimum of three days in the Santa Clara office, providing opportunities for professional growth within a mission-driven organization.
